While West Brompton may not boast a ticket office, it provides ticket machines for your convenience. Travelers should note that tickets purchased online cannot be collected at this station. The station is equipped with smartcard validators, allowing seamless travel for London Underground services. Those with accessibility needs will find the induction loop and accessible ticket machines particularly useful. However, the station does not have waiting rooms, toilets, or refreshment facilities—so it’s wise to plan accordingly.
Thanks to step-free access available through lifts, West Brompton ensures smoother mobility for everyone. Whether you are using the eastbound District line services or London Overground, the facilities accommodate hassle-free transit. Despite these amenities, there are no accessible toilets or wheelchairs available, so it's advisable to plan for alternative arrangements if necessary.
West Brompton is a nexus of transport links, facilitating easy connections to destinations near and far. The station offers convenient access to the District Line, making local travel a breeze. For those heading to Gatwick Airport, the station provides connections with National Rail services, while Earls Court serves as an interchange for travelers to Heathrow Airport via the Piccadilly Line. Local bus services are also available with details accessible through TfL’s interactive map, ensuring you are never short of travel options.

At Gordon Hill station, you can buy and collect your tickets at the convenience of ticket machines available on site, which support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. The ticket office is open from 06:35 to 13:00 on weekdays, and slightly later on Saturdays, from 07:45 to 14:10. Smartcard holders will find validators and issuance services readily available here. If you require some assistance, while customer help points are not installed, you can find staff support at designated help points and CCTV is operational across the station premises for enhanced security.
Accessibility may pose a challenge as the station falls under Category C, meaning there is no step-free access and ramps for train access aren't provided. If assistance is needed, it is advisable to arrive at least 20 minutes prior to your journey to ensure timely help. Although there are no accessible toilets or waiting rooms, the seating area is available, allowing for some respite.
Gordon Hill is well-connected for those looking to continue their journey beyond the station. Information on local bus services is easily accessible with an Onward Travel Information Map, ensuring seamless transition to your next mode of conveyance. Although cycle hire isn’t possible, sheltered and CCTV-monitored bicycle storage is available, allowing travelers to park their bikes securely at the station entrance.
